Polymeric Colorant Market was valued at USD 4.5 Billion in 2022 and is projected to reach USD 7.2 Billion by 2030, growing at a CAGR of 7.5% from 2024 to 2030.
The polymeric colorant market is experiencing significant growth across various applications due to the versatility and broad range of uses of polymeric colorants in numerous industries. Polymeric colorants are widely utilized for providing rich, durable, and vibrant colors while maintaining high levels of stability and consistency. They offer benefits such as improved aesthetics, enhanced performance, and environmental compliance, making them an ideal choice for various commercial applications. These colorants are used extensively in industries like personal care, automotive, aviation, and a host of other sectors, each with specific requirements and challenges.

In the personal care sector, polymeric colorants are employed to enhance the visual appeal of products such as cosmetics, skincare, haircare, and toiletries. These colorants not only improve the aesthetic quality of products but also contribute to the formulation's stability and long-lasting performance. Given the increasing demand for innovative, safe, and eco-friendly personal care products, polymeric colorants provide an attractive option due to their non-toxicity, resistance to fading, and ability to adhere to a variety of surfaces. Their ability to create vivid shades, stay stable over time, and support formulations with minimal environmental impact is driving their increasing adoption in the personal care industry. Moreover, consumer preferences for natural and organic beauty products are influencing the market towards polymeric colorants derived from sustainable and renewable resources, further shaping the growth prospects in this application segment.
As the global market for personal care products continues to expand, particularly in emerging economies, the demand for polymeric colorants in personal care applications is anticipated to grow. The increasing awareness of skin sensitivity and allergenic reactions to synthetic dyes has led to a preference for polymeric colorants that offer reduced risks and enhanced compatibility with diverse skin types. Polymeric colorants are also employed in the production of packaging for personal care products, offering an additional dimension of branding and aesthetic differentiation. As such, the personal care application segment represents a highly dynamic and growing segment in the polymeric colorant market.
In the automotive industry, polymeric colorants are crucial in providing vibrant, long-lasting colors for exterior and interior parts of vehicles, such as paint coatings, trim components, and seat fabrics. The use of polymeric colorants allows for the creation of aesthetically appealing vehicle designs while ensuring that the color remains durable and resistant to environmental stressors like UV light, heat, and moisture. Polymeric colorants in the automotive sector provide superior color consistency and are often selected for their ability to deliver high performance in extreme conditions. They are especially favored for their stability and resistance to fading, making them an essential element in modern automotive design where durability and long-term visual appeal are key considerations. As the automotive industry shifts towards more sustainable practices, there is an increasing demand for environmentally-friendly, non-toxic polymeric colorants that can align with these goals.
The growing trend toward custom and personalized vehicle designs, along with the demand for innovative automotive materials, is expected to fuel the demand for polymeric colorants in the automotive sector. As consumers increasingly seek unique and eco-conscious vehicles, the industry will continue to explore advanced formulations that integrate polymeric colorants to achieve both aesthetic and functional objectives. In addition, the growing popularity of electric vehicles and automotive advancements in design and materials technology will drive further developments in the polymeric colorant market. This segment is poised for continued growth as the automotive industry increasingly focuses on integrating high-performance, durable, and sustainable color solutions into vehicle design.
In the aviation industry, polymeric colorants are primarily used to enhance the appearance of aircraft exteriors and interiors, offering both aesthetic appeal and performance-enhancing properties. Polymeric colorants are employed in the coatings for aircraft bodies, ensuring that the color does not fade or degrade under extreme environmental conditions such as high altitudes, UV exposure, and frequent temperature fluctuations. The aviation industry requires highly durable and weather-resistant colors that can withstand the stresses of flight while maintaining their visual appeal. Polymeric colorants are preferred for their superior adhesion, resistance to oxidation, and ability to maintain vibrancy over extended periods, making them a critical component in aviation applications. Additionally, the use of polymeric colorants helps in achieving sleek, modern finishes that contribute to the aircraft's overall design and branding.
With the ongoing advancements in aircraft design, particularly in terms of fuel efficiency and lightweight materials, the use of polymeric colorants in the aviation industry is also evolving. The demand for sustainable and eco-friendly materials in aviation is rising, prompting the adoption of polymeric colorants made from renewable resources or those that reduce environmental impact. These trends are likely to shape the future of colorant formulations in the industry, fostering innovation in both aesthetic and functional qualities. The aviation application segment of the polymeric colorant market is expected to see steady growth as airlines continue to invest in modernizing fleets and adopting materials that support both performance and environmental goals.
The 'Others' segment of the polymeric colorant market includes a wide range of applications across industries such as packaging, construction, textiles, and consumer goods. In these industries, polymeric colorants are used for providing rich, stable, and durable colors in products ranging from plastic containers to fabrics and building materials. In packaging, for instance, polymeric colorants are used to create vibrant, long-lasting colors for bottles, labels, and other packaging components, helping brands stand out and appeal to consumers. In textiles, these colorants are utilized to provide vibrant and lasting hues to fabrics used in clothing, upholstery, and other textile applications. These colorants are increasingly sought after for their environmental benefits, with industries seeking sustainable alternatives to traditional pigments and dyes.
As sustainability becomes a key focus across various industries, the 'Others' segment is likely to experience growth in the demand for polymeric colorants made from renewable and non-toxic materials. Industries such as construction are also adopting polymeric colorants to add color to building materials, with a growing preference for environmentally friendly and durable options that are safe for both people and the environment. Furthermore, the expansion of the global middle class and increasing demand for consumer goods will continue to propel the growth of this segment. This diverse application range, coupled with the rising demand for eco-friendly solutions, will likely drive innovations and foster the adoption of polymeric colorants in new and emerging markets.

What are polymeric colorants?
Polymeric colorants are dyes or pigments bound to polymers that offer enhanced color stability and durability in various applications like personal care, automotive, and more.
What industries use polymeric colorants?
Polymeric colorants are used in industries such as personal care, automotive, aviation, construction, textiles, and packaging.
Why are polymeric colorants preferred over traditional dyes?
They offer better durability, resistance to fading, and enhanced stability, making them ideal for long-lasting color in various products.
